## Capacity Note: Role-Based Access in the Fernwick Wiki

Support should expect heavier permission-check traffic after the Fernwick wiki moves to role-based access. Every page load now resolves the viewer's role graph, and deep team hierarchies can fan out into hundreds of lookups. We cache resolved roles per session, but cache churn during reorg weeks will raise latency, so plan staffing around those windows. The cache and fan-out limits we currently enforce are shown below.

tuning table, fawip-fahag:
WEIGHTS = {
    "novwyn": 452,
    "casdor": 675,
}

Quillcheck validates docs bundles before publish. Plugin authors: your linter rule packs are artifacts and must be signed. Unsigned packs are rejected by the Fernhollow registry with no retry.

Process: build the pack, run `quillcheck verify --strict`, then sign. Do not sign packs that emit warnings; the registry treats a warning-bearing signed pack as tampered. Rotation happens quarterly; stale signatures fail after the grace window. One key per namespace, no sharing across packs. Sign with the current publishing key, shown below.

deploy key for yajop-fahop: bky3_h1v

## Service Accounts — StormFan Alert Fan-Out

The fan-out worker authenticates to the internal dispatch tier using the svc-stormfan account. Rotate quarterly; scopes are limited to publish-only on alert topics. If deliveries stall during your shift, verify the worker is using the current credential, reproduced below for reference.

API key for kaweg-hahif: kto4_rAjZ

If the Binhawk pick-list optimizer starts emitting routes longer than the warehouse baseline, check the cost-matrix cache first; a stale matrix after a layout change is the usual cause. Restarting the solver pod forces a rebuild and is safe during business hours. Reviewers merging layout changes should verify the matrix version bump described here:

wiki page, tahaf-tajog: https://jira.ordindyn.corp/pipeline

Handover — cron migration to Weftflow

Moved six of nine cron jobs to the Weftflow engine; the remaining three (billing sweep, cache warm, digest) run legacy until Friday. Don't enable both schedulers for the same job. If the Weftflow admin account locks during cutover, unlock it with the passphrase below.

strongbox words: raleth-olieth-zoreth-holox-ulaius-novath